Protect Your Deposit - Contents Insurance Quotes for Tenants

Although as a tenant you may not require buildings insurance, there are many reasons why it is important to consider tenant contents insurance for your home;

Contents Insurance will ensure your own belongings and possessions in your rented property up to your selected sum insured are covered from damage or theft. This will included your furniture, televisions, personal computers and laptops, electrical equipment, furnishings, clothing, jewellery and personal possessions whilst in your home.

It is also important to have tenants contents insurance to protect your deposit for accidental damage to your landlord's contents and fixtures & fittings for which as a tenant you would be responsible for.

The quotes we will provide can cover loss or damage as a result of all standard risk for example the policy will usually include:

- Fire, Smoke, Explosion, Lightning, Earthquake.
- Storm or Flood.
- Theft or Attempted Theft consequent upon violent and forcible entry.
- Escape of Water.
- Malicious Damage consequent upon violent and forcible entry.
- Riots or Civil Commotion.
- Collision, Falling Trees or Branches.
- Lamp-posts, TV aerials or Masts.

Additional benefits include:

- Accidental Damage to Home Entertainment Equipment.
- Accidental Damage to Mirrors and Glass.
- Accidental Loss of Oil and Metered Water.
- Temporary Removal.
- Alternative Accommodation.
- Tenants Liability to the public

Accidental damage to Landlords Contents

In addition to contents insurance most insurers offer accidental damage insurance for a small additional fee. If you feel you're 'clumsy', have young children or simply have a lot of breakable items in your house then Accidental Damage may be worth considering. Some policies also include full accidental damage cover to landlord's contents, fixtures & fittings which provides peace of mind for both landlords and tenants, as well as helping to protect a tenant's deposit.

Personal Possessions Cover

Personal Possessions cover for personal items can be taken out provided that they belong to you or your family and that they are mainly used for private purposes. This includes personal effects, valuables and money. You will be able to select the sum insured you want for loss or accidental damage to your clothing, watches, jewellery, spectacles, other valuables, mobile phones and pedal cycles whilst away from your home.

Tenants Public Liability Insurance

With some tenant contents insurance policies Tenants public liability insurance can be included; this would cover damage arising from your occupation of the insurer's property.
